Hi there, I understand that travel into bolivia requires a yellow fever vaccination card which I will not have, does anyone have a suggestion as to how I could verify if I am going to have trouble upon entry, as in a link to bolivian customs and immigration, my google searching is getting me nowhere. thx.

Google=yellow fever bolivia
1st hit = British Foreign Office :-)
Bolivia travel advice
Read down and it says they have started checking.
Read further down it says there is yellow fever present in some areas.
So, if you want to take the chance and enter without a vaccination then that is your call. It is also relevant to other countries (Russia) that if you have a passport stamp for somewhere like Bolivia they will want to see the certificate.
Bribing border guards ? Don't. You make it harder for the next set of travelers.
Try and get a vaccination where you are now.
Think of it as protecting yourself.
